From what part of the neuron are neurotransmitters released?
NT are released from synaptic vesicles located in the axon terminals.
Name two ways NTs in synapses are deactivated?
Reuptake and enzymes.
What type of chemicals are manufactured in the body?
Endogenous
What type of chemicals are manufactured outside the body?
Exogenous
